Basic Information
Product Name: 1,3,4,6,7,9,9b-Heptaazaphenalene-2,5,8-triamine
Common Name: Melem
CAS No: 1502-47-2
Molecular Formula:
C6H6N10
Molecular Weight: 218.18 g/mol
Classification: Heptazine derivative, nitrogen-rich heterocyclic compound
Physical & Chemical Properties
Appearance: White to off-white crystalline powder
Density: 1.62 g/cm3 (approx)
Boiling Point: 348.86°C (approx)
Solubility: Insoluble in water, ethanol, methanol, DMF, DMSO; insoluble in most common organic solvents
Stability: Thermally stable (decomposition >500°C); light-sensitive
pKa: -0.74±0.20 (predicted)

Main Uses
- MOF/COF/POP monomer: Building block for porous carbon nitride materials (PCN-1/2), covalent organic frameworks (COFs), and porous organic polymers (POPs)
- Flame retardant: High nitrogen content, used in fire-resistant and high-temperature materials
- 2D polymer precursor: Synthesis of nitrogen-rich 2D conjugated polymers
- Research reagent: Organic electronics, photocatalysis, and energy storage research
